What Is ICBC Covered Counselling?

The Insurance Corporation of British Columbia (ICBC) recognizes the importance of mental health after a motor vehicle accident. That’s why they provide fully funded counselling sessions to anyone injured in a crash—drivers, passengers, cyclists, or pedestrians/witnesses.

Key benefits of ICBC covered counselling:

  • Up to 12 sessions fully covered within 12 weeks of your accident (extensions available if needed)

  • No upfront costs—ICBC is billed directly

  • Accessible in Victoria, BC or online anywhere in Canada

Why Mental Health Support Matters After an Accident

After a collision, it’s normal to feel shaken, anxious, or overwhelmed. Many people experience:

  • Anxiety or panic attacks

  • Trouble sleeping

  • Flashbacks or nightmares

  • Depression or mood changes

  • Difficulty returning to daily routines

Counselling can help you:

  • Process trauma and stress

  • Build coping strategies

  • Regain confidence and control

  • Heal emotionally and move forward
